# **PRN CT Technologist** **Location:** DFW Area, Texas **Schedule:** PRN / As Needed (Monday–Friday) **Compensation:** Competitive pay based on experience ## **Requirements** - Current **Texas Medical Board (MRT)** certification - Current **ARRT (R)(CT)** or board-eligible for the CT Registry - Graduate of an accredited Radiologic Technology program - Current BLS certification preferred - IV certification and contrast administration experience preferred - Excellent patient care and communication skills - Ability to work independently and as part of a team ## **Job Summary** North Star Diagnostic Imaging is seeking a dependable, patient-focused **PRN CT Technologist** to join our team. The ideal candidate is committed to providing exceptional patient care while producing high-quality diagnostic CT imaging in a fast-paced outpatient environment. This position offers flexible PRN scheduling with opportunities to work at multiple outpatient imaging centers throughout the DFW area. **Locations:** https://www.northstardiagnosticimaging.com/locations ## **Responsibilities** - Perform high-quality diagnostic CT examinations following physician orders and established imaging protocols. - Prepare, position, and educate patients to ensure a safe and comfortable imaging experience. - Safely administer intravenous contrast media in accordance with physician orders and departmental protocols. - Monitor patients before, during, and after contrast administration, recognizing and responding appropriately to adverse reactions. - Operate CT equipment safely and efficiently while maintaining exceptional image quality. - Verify patient identity, exam orders, and clinical history prior to imaging. - Practice radiation safety by following ALARA principles and utilizing dose optimization techniques. - Accurately document patient information, imaging procedures, and contrast administration in the electronic medical record. - Maintain CT equipment and report any equipment concerns or malfunctions. - Follow infection prevention, safety, and quality assurance protocols. - Collaborate with radiologists, technologists, and clinical staff to provide outstanding patient care. - Maintain a clean, organized, and professional work environment. - Assist with other duties as needed to support departmental operations. ## **What We Offer** - Flexible PRN scheduling - Competitive pay based on experience - Modern outpatient imaging environment - Supportive team culture - Opportunities for additional shifts across multiple DFW locations - Opportunity to work with advanced CT technology - Potential opportunities to cross-train into other modalities as available If you're a dependable, patient-centered **CT Technologist** looking for flexible PRN work with a growing outpatient imaging organization, we'd love to hear from you!
